Market Segmentation: Types Fueling the Solvent-Resistant Polyamide Films Market
The Solvent-Resistant Polyamide Films Market is broadly segmented by film type, each catering to unique application demands. Unoriented Polyamide Films (OPA) constitute a significant share due to their superior chemical resistance, flexibility, and thermal stability. These films are heavily used in industrial coatings, automotive fuel system components, and general packaging where solvent exposure is frequent. Their versatility supports steady growth in various industries experiencing rising solvent-resistant film demand.
Biaxially Oriented Polyamide Films (BOPA) are another major segment distinguished by enhanced mechanical strength and barrier properties. BOPA films dominate in high-performance packaging applications, including food and pharmaceuticals, due to their ability to withstand rigorous chemical environments while maintaining film integrity. Electronics also rely on BOPA films for flexible printed circuits and insulation layers where chemical resistance and dimensional stability are critical. The growth of multilayer film structures incorporating BOPA supports expansion within the solvent-resistant polyamide films market by offering improved performance characteristics.

Impact of Raw Material Costs on Solvent-Resistant Polyamide Films Price Trend
Raw material costs, primarily polyamide resins and additives, remain the largest determinants of the Solvent-Resistant Polyamide Films Price Trend. Crude oil price fluctuations directly affect polyamide feedstock availability and cost. For example, periods of crude price spikes have historically led to short-term increases in polyamide film prices, impacting end-user industries. However, manufacturers are increasingly adopting cost-effective polymerization processes and exploring bio-based alternatives to stabilize pricing.
Additionally, trade policies and tariffs between major producing and consuming regions can influence film prices by affecting import-export dynamics. For example, recent tariff adjustments between Asia and North America have temporarily affected the Solvent-Resistant Polyamide Films Price in the US market, prompting some manufacturers to diversify supply chains. Overall, raw material cost volatility necessitates agile pricing strategies to maintain competitiveness while meeting rising demand.
